Transaction 95bc5998ab68840d3df9c76d25de8d85cc758e2d935d6fb36cb8511434a268a3
1 Input
2 Outputs
- 95bc5998ab68840d3df9c76d25de8d85cc758e2d935d6fb36cb8511434a268a3:0
- 95bc5998ab68840d3df9c76d25de8d85cc758e2d935d6fb36cb8511434a268a3:1
value 68447
address 39FWd9EVfzvZiKrvjxx9Max68isN9mHwVx
value 35402473
address 16WccL1zpHi3hPNznem9GZvdvexvAi9r7n